explain why the magnetic field in solenoid is Greater if the solenoid has an iron core?

Answers

Answer:

he magnetic field is greater because the magnetization of the material is added

Explanation:

The magnetic field in a solenoid is given by the relation

          B₀o = μ₀ n I

where n is the density of turns and I the current

When we put a magnetic material inside solenoid

the magnetic field is

         B = B₀ + μ₀ M

where M is called the magnetization of the material and corresponds to the alignment of the magnetic moments of the atoms with the field, therefore the total field is much greater, it should be noted that the part of Bo increases with the current, but the magnetization has a maximum value.

Consequently the magnetic field is greater because the magnetization of the material is added

what is lateral shift​

Answers

Answer:

Lateral Shift When a ray of light is incident on a glass slab, the emergent ray coming out of the slab will be parallel to the incident ray. The perpendicular distance between the direction of incident ray and emergent ray is called the lateral Shift. It is denoted by d.

If a riding lawnmower engine exerts 19 hp in one minute to move the mower, how much work is done? (Hint convert: 1 watt equals 0.00135962 hp)

Answers

Answer:

Work done = 838470 Joules.

Explanation:

Given the following data;

Power = 19 hp

Time = 1 minute to seconds = 60 seconds.

Next, we would convert the unit of power in "hp" to "Watt."

1 Watt = 0.00135962 horsepower

x Watt = 19 horsepower

Cross-multiplying, we have;

19 = 0.00135962x

x = 19/0.00135962

x = 13974.5 Watts.

Now, to find the work done in moving the mower;

Work done = power * time

Substituting into the formula, we have;

Work done = 13974.5 * 60

Work done = 838470 Joules.

a 2kg book falls off the top of a 2.3m bookshelf. how much work is required to lift the book back to it's original position? gravity acceleration is 9.58 m/s ²​

Answers

Answer:

44.068 J

Explanation:

From the question,

Work(W) = mgh............... Equation 1

Where m = mass of the book, g = acceleraton due to gravity, h = height.

Given: m = 2 kg, h = 2.3 m, g = 9.58 m/s²

Substitute these values into equation 1

W = 2×2.3×9.58

W = 44.068 J

Hence the work required to lift the book is 44.068 J
